The overview below groups typical Exit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kingston,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Cost of Exit Window Installation - The typical cost range for installing an exit window varies from approximately $1,200 to $3,500, depending on window size and complexity. Larger or custom-sized windows tend to be on the higher end of the spectrum. Local service providers can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for exit window installation generally fall between $600 and $1,800. Factors influencing labor fees include the window type, accessibility, and existing structural modifications needed. Contact local contractors for precise labor estimates in Kingston, WA area.
Material Costs - The price for materials such as windows, framing, and finishing materials typically ranges from $600 to $2,000. Premium or energy-efficient window options may increase overall material expenses. Local pros can advise on suitable materials within your budget.
Additional Fees - Additional costs, including permits, site cleanup, and potential structural reinforcement, can add $200 to $800 to the total. These fees vary based on project scope and local building requirements. Consulting with local service providers can help clarify potential extra expenses.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
